In 2012, World Health Organization (WHO) and UNICEF defined menstrual hygiene management as women using clean products, understanding “basic facts linked to the menstrual cycle,” and knowing how to manage it safely. DfG’s work helps people have the tools they need to menstruate with dignity.

DfG and READ Bhutan teamed up to distribute 351 Kits and menstrual health education to schoolgirls in Trashigang. Kits were made by DfG Nepal, sponsored by Strathfield NSW, and flown in by Drukair. A true global effort for menstrual health! 🌍

Last month, DfG delivered a two-day menstrual health educator training in Kampala, Uganda with equipping eight educators and four DfG staff. These leaders will play a key role in helping us reach 1,500 refugees with essential menstrual health education and resources this year.
